There is tremendous excitement that the State of Nevada has recently passed legislation that offers Educational Choice Scholarships to our families in financial need, and Educational Savings Accounts to the children of those families who would like to make the choice and the change from public school to parochial school this year. This has been a prayer of the Church for decades; we are overjoyed that Nevada is the first state to respond to this petition in such a magnanimous way. We encourage all our parents to apply to these scholarships/savings accounts as soon as possible! The state websites that you should contact regularly are:
